Why Choose a Mesothelioma Law Firm?
A mesothelioma law firm can help patients receive compensation for medical bills, lost wages and other expenses. They can also help with asbestos trust funds.
They will examine your medical and work history to determine if there's mesothelioma that is a valid claim. They will investigate the incident and identify any responsible parties.
National Firms
Contrary to local asbestos lawyers, national mesothelioma law firms are able to represent victims across multiple states. This versatility is beneficial for asbestos victims since their exposure could be a result of exposure to asbestos in multiple places. Lawyers from these firms know how to submit claims in all applicable jurisdictions and can help victims in pursuing the largest amount of compensation that is possible.
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ma can examine medical records of patients to determine their exposure to asbestos. They can then assist to seek compensation from responsible parties. These firms have access to various resources that can be used to strengthen a case. This includes documents from the company, expert witness testimony, and mesothelioma studies. Attorneys can provide legal assessments and also explain the compensation process.
Many experienced mesothelioma attorneys have experience representing clients in asbestos trust fund claims. This ensures that the compensation is sufficient to cover the expenses of treatment and other costs associated with mesothelioma. Attorneys can help veterans determine whether additional compensation is available from government-funded trusts that were established to aid veterans who were exposed to asbestos during their service in the military.
The best mesothelioma attorneys offer free legal consultations. They are also able to review a patient's medical records free of charge and only charge if they are awarded compensation. The firms have lawyers who are aware of the costs of asbestos litigation, and are determined to make sure that the victims receive the amount of compensation they deserve.

Contingency Fees
If a person is diagnosed with mesothelioma or has lost a loved one to this cancer that is caused by asbestos it is essential to work with an attorney who can assist in obtaining compensation. This can help victims and their families cover medical expenses, deal with the loss of income and other financial difficulties related to the disease.
Dedicated mesothelioma attorneys at top firms can make sure that victims receive the compensation they deserve to cover these expenses. They have a proven track of obtaining multimillion-dollar settlements and judgements for asbestos victims. They are familiar with each state's legal system in regards to mesothelioma cases.
The mesothelioma attorneys at the top firms also work on a contingency fee basis so the victim or their loved ones do not have to pay any upfront costs. The attorneys are only paid if the case is successful and the victims receive compensation. In most cases, there are other expenses that the client could be accountable for, including photocopy expenses or court filing fees.
